What Barkley's Climate Actually Does to Siding
Salt Air and Corrosion
Proximity to the bay means a fine, near-constant film of salt-laden moisture settles on exterior surfaces. Over years, that accelerates the breakdown of untreated fasteners, cheap trim coil, and paint films that aren't formulated to resist salt exposure. It's a slow process, which is exactly why it gets overlooked until a repaint or repair reveals corrosion that's been building for a decade.
Driving Rain
Storms coming off the water don't just fall straight down — they drive rain sideways into wall assemblies, which puts real stress on laps, seams, and butt joints. A siding system with poor water-shedding geometry, or one installed with tight or caulked joints instead of proper overlap and drainage, will eventually let water behind the cladding.
The Long Moss Season
Whatcom County's wet season runs long, and shaded or north-facing walls in Barkley stay damp for extended stretches. That's ideal growing conditions for moss and algae, which hold moisture against the siding surface and, over time, degrade paint films and any substrate that isn't genuinely rot-resistant.
Why James Hardie Fiber Cement Fits This Climate
James Hardie siding is fiber cement — sand, cement, and cellulose fiber, engineered and pressed under high pressure, then cured. It doesn't absorb water the way wood-based products do, and it won't rot, delaminate, or feed the kind of organic growth that thrives on cellulose-based sidings in a climate like ours. For homes exposed to salt air and driving rain, that's the difference between siding that shrugs off the weather and siding that's fighting a losing battle from year one.
James Hardie also engineers its products by climate zone (HZ5 for the Pacific Northwest), which accounts for freeze-thaw cycling and sustained moisture exposure rather than treating every region the same. Add the factory-applied ColorPlus finish — baked on under controlled conditions rather than field-applied — and you get a color coat that resists fading, chipping, and the kind of early wear that shows up fast on a house getting hit with sideways rain and salt air.

What a Correct Installation Actually Involves
James Hardie siding is only as good as the installation behind it. A rushed or improperly detailed install can undercut even the best cladding material, especially in a climate that gives water every opportunity to find a way in. A correct job includes:
- A weather-resistive barrier installed and lapped correctly behind the siding, with all penetrations properly flashed
- Rain-screen or drainage gap details where the wall assembly calls for it, so moisture that does get behind the cladding can escape
- Correct fastener type, spacing, and embedment per James Hardie's published fastening schedule — not shortcuts that void the warranty
- Proper clearance between siding and grade, decks, roof lines, and other transitions where water tends to collect
- Factory-mitered or properly caulked joints at butt seams, with the right sealant for a coastal-exposure climate
- Trim, flashing, and fastener hardware rated for the corrosion exposure this area sees
Skip any one of these steps and you can end up with a product that looks right for a few years but fails to deliver the 30+ year performance James Hardie siding is capable of. This is the part of the job that doesn't show up in a photo but determines whether the investment holds up.

Choosing a Product Line and Color
James Hardie makes several siding profiles, and the right one depends on the home's style and how much of the existing look you want to preserve or change.
| Product | Look | Best Fit For |
|---|---|---|
| HardiePlank Lap Siding | Traditional horizontal lap | Most Barkley home styles, from craftsman to contemporary |
| HardieShingle | Staggered or straight-edge shingle | Accent gables, dormers, or a full cottage-style exterior |
| HardiePanel | Vertical panel with battens | Modern builds and mixed-material accent walls |
| HardieTrim | Smooth or woodgrain boards | Corners, fascia, and window/door surrounds on any of the above |
ColorPlus finishes come in a range of tones that hold up to UV and salt exposure better than field-applied paint. For homes that get direct afternoon sun off the water, darker colors will run slightly warmer and should be discussed against the specific product's heat-sensitivity rating; for shaded or north-facing walls, color choice matters less than making sure drainage and airflow are handled correctly to keep moss from taking hold in the first place.

Keeping Moss and Algae From Taking Hold
Even with a correctly installed Hardie system, Barkley's wet season means north-facing and shaded walls need occasional attention to stay clean. A short annual routine goes a long way:
- Rinse siding gently once a year, focusing on shaded walls and areas under overhangs
- Keep gutters clear so overflow isn't running down the wall face
- Trim back vegetation that's shading siding or holding moisture against it
- Check caulked joints annually and re-caulk if you see cracking or gaps
- Address any moss growth early with a gentle wash rather than pressure-washing, which can damage the finish
This is far less maintenance than wood siding demands, but it's not zero-maintenance — and homeowners who go in with realistic expectations get the most out of the material.
